Adopting means implementing intentional, human-centered strategies:- Clear and Tactile Input Systems : Using contrasting textures, bold labels, and strategically placed lacing patterns helps users with visual impairments interact confidently with handles, buttons, or closure points.
- Universal Material Choices : Selecting soft yet durable fabrics—recycled polyester, plant-based leathers, or organic cotton—ensures user comfort while reducing carbon footprints.
- Simplified Form Interactions : Forms and digital interfaces benefit from spacious, high-contrast labels and keyboard navigability, supporting those with motor or cognitive differences.
- Modular and Repairable Construction : Designing components that users can easily replace encourages longer product lifespans, cutting waste and supporting inclusive maintenance.
